Lauren Jauregui Gets Honest About Taking a Step Back from Social Media & What Fans Can Expect In the Future


Lauren Jauregui has cut back on her social media presence and here’s why.

The Dancing with the Stars contestant shares that she has started giving a lot more thought to what she feels comfortable sharing with the world via social media platforms. There are some thing she would prefer to reveal through her music.

Speaking to People, Lauren shared insight into her new single “Ego,” which is the first new song off of her upcoming album.

“I think my long-time fans know me, and I feel like this just is the next chapter of me — what I’ve been internally moving through especially,” the singer said. “I feel like I’ve been AWOL on socials, to be honest. I went through a dark night of the soul, and that’s a very jarring experience that makes being perceived, especially misconstrued, really painful.”

“I was just like, ‘What are we even doing social media for?’ Then, I woke up, and I was like, ‘Because the kids are on social media, that’s where everybody’s at. That’s where everybody’s talking. That’s where everybody’s connecting.’ I’ve been in that fluctuation.”

But all of that being said, she doesn’t intend to withdraw completely. It’s more like now her follows can anticipate her being “more present and having something to say that’s more direct and intentional than just all my thoughts.”

Most of all, the 27-year-old former Fifth Harmony member wants to connect with people through music.

“I really do sincerely believe art has always been the saving grace in dark times, the thing that illuminates and brings about knowledge and the ability to connect with one another even if we’re different,” she added.
